Sony is in news again with the addition of two more cameras to their Cyber-shot range. Christened as the DSC-TX1 and DSC-WX1, the two cameras come integrated with the Exmor R back illuminated CMOS sensor technology, which augments their sensitivity. The cameras also boast of providing clear and crisp images even when there is low-light surroundings.
The built-in handy twilight and anti-motion blur multi-shot modes utilize the speed of the Exmor R CMOS sensor to take 5 different images in not more than a second. The Sony’s BIONZ processor, then again, turns the images into a single image with amazing detail.
As the reviews, these compact and tiny devices are also built-in with the Sweep Panorama, which makes use of the BIONZ processor and the Exmor R CMOS sensor to offer striking panoramic photos. Plus, the cameras boast of a burst shooting mode, which can record 10 frames per second.
The 10.2mp TX1 is measured just 16.5mm and comes in an advanced look. Its famous curves additionally boosts its appeal. Its 3-inch Clear Photo LCD Plus touch panel helps you scroll through the images with only single flick of a finger. The TX-1 also features 4x telescopic zoom, Carl Zeiss Vario-Tessar lens and Sony’s Optical SteadyShot image stabilization technology.
Measured only 3Q of an inch, the 10.2mp WX-1 boasts of a 2.7-inch Clear Photo LCD Plus display and Sony’s G lens with 24-120mm 5x optical zoom.
These cameras are also featured with Face Detection technology, Intelligent Auto (iAuto) mode, intelligent Scene alongside nine Scene Selection modes. The cameras also come in built with Smile Shutter technology. They also have the capacity of recording HD videos in 720p format. The cameras can record and store around 29 min videos in 720p, MPEG4 format.
The Sony Cyber-shot DSC-WX1 and DSC-TX1 can now be availed through all leading retail stores and retail owners of Sony all over India. The TX-1, hued in gray, comes with the price tag of around Rs. 20,990, whereas the WX-1, in black color, has been priced up to Rs. 19,990.
